Hello everyone! I'm relatively new to trading USDJPY, and I'm trying to understand the current trend. The SMAs seem to be clustered around the current price point, but the 200-day SMA is quite a bit higher. Does anyone have any thoughts on how the SMAs might influence the pair in the coming days? I'm particularly interested in long-term positions.

Update: After doing some further analysis, I've noticed that the Bollinger Bands are quite narrow at the moment. This often indicates a period of consolidation before a breakout. Given the neutral RSI, I'm struggling to determine which direction the breakout is likely to occur. I'm thinking of setting up alerts at both the upper and lower Bollinger Bands to prepare for either scenario. Any advice on confirming a breakout before committing to a position? Hi @AmeliaClarke, regarding the SMAs, I would focus more on the 20 and 50 SMAs for short-term trends. The 200 SMA is indeed higher, but it's a lagging indicator. In an uptrend like this, watch for the price to bounce off the 20 SMA as support. If it breaks below, that could signal a trend reversal. Always consider risk management! 👨‍💻
